Senate Amendment 5780

Amendment Text

PAG LIN
  1  1    Amend the Senate amendment, H-9118, to House File
  1  2 2498, as amended, passed, and reprinted by the House,
  1  3 as follows:
  1  4    #1.  Page 1, by inserting after line 9 the
  1  5 following:
  1  6    "#   .  Page 6, line 2, by striking the figure
  1  7 "116.00" and inserting the following:  "118.00"."
  1  8    #2.  Page 1, by striking line 10.
  1  9    #3.  Page 1, line 12, by striking the figure
  1 10 "655,898" and inserting the following:  "835,898".
  1 11    #4.  Page 1, by striking lines 30 and 31 and
  1 12 inserting the following:
  1 13    "#   .  Page 13, by striking lines 2 through 6, and
  1 14 inserting the following:  "gambling game license
  1 15 holder.""
  1 16    #5.  By striking page 1, line 43, through page 2,
  1 17 line 10, and inserting the following:  "under section
  1 18 730.5."
  1 19    #6.  Page 2, by inserting after line 30 the
  1 20 following:
  1 21    "The Iowa public employees' retirement system
  1 22 division shall use a competitive bid process for the
  1 23 proposed acquisition of a headquarters building and
  1 24 related facilities and accept, if any, the most cost-
  1 25 effective bid which best meets the needs of the
  1 26 system's members."
  1 27    #7.  Page 2, by inserting after line 30 the
  1 28 following:
  1 29    "If a headquarters building and related facilities
  1 30 are acquired, the Iowa public employees' retirement
  1 31 system division shall reimburse the city or other
  1 32 local government where the building and related
  1 33 facilities are located for police and fire
  1 34 protection."
  1 35    #8.  Page 3, line 11, by inserting after the figure
  1 36 "35,000" the following:
  1 37    "It is the intent of the general assembly that each
  1 38 public retirement system responsible for performing
  1 39 the examination as described in this subsection shall
  1 40 share equally the cost of conducting the examination.
  1 41 Moneys appropriated in this subsection shall be used
  1 42 by the Iowa public employees' retirement system to
  1 43 provide its proportionate share of the cost of the
  1 44 examination."
  1 45    #9.  Page 4, by inserting after line 9 the
  1 46 following:
  1 47    "#   .  Page 23, by inserting after line 16 the
  1 48 following:
  1 49    "Sec.    .  Section 47.8, subsection 1, Code 1997,
  1 50 is amended to read as follows:
  2  1    1.  A state voter registration commission is
  2  2 established which shall meet at least quarterly to
  2  3 make and review policy, adopt rules, and establish
  2  4 procedures to be followed by the registrar in
  2  5 discharging the duties of that office, and to promote
  2  6 interagency cooperation and planning.  The commission
  2  7 shall consist of the state commissioner of elections
  2  8 or the state commissioner's designee, the state
  2  9 chairpersons of the two political parties whose
  2 10 candidates for president of the United States or
  2 11 governor, as the case may be, received the greatest
  2 12 and next greatest number of votes in the most recent
  2 13 general election, or their respective designees, and a
  2 14 two county commissioner commissioners of registration
  2 15 or their designated employees, one from each political
  2 16 party whose candidates for president of the United
  2 17 States or governor, as the case may be, received the
  2 18 greatest and the next greatest number of votes in the
  2 19 most recent general election, appointed by the
  2 20 president of the Iowa state association of county
  2 21 auditors, or an employee of the commissioner.  Each
  2 22 county commissioner or commissioner's designee shall
  2 23 serve two-year staggered terms.  The commission
  2 24 membership shall be balanced by political party
  2 25 affiliation pursuant to section 69.16.  Members shall
  2 26 serve without additional salary or reimbursement.
  2 27    The state commissioner of elections, or the state
  2 28 commissioner's designee, shall serve as chairperson of
  2 29 the state voter registration commission.  The state
  2 30 commissioner of elections, or the state commissioner's
  2 31 designee, shall be an ex officio, nonvoting member of
  2 32 the commission.  The state commissioner shall perform
  2 33 the administrative tasks required of that office by
  2 34 the commission.
  2 35    The commission shall organize and elect a
  2 36 chairperson annually at its first meeting held in the
  2 37 calendar year.""

  2 47    #11.  Page 4, by inserting after line 10 the
  2 48 following:
  2 49    "#   .  Page 24, by inserting after line 3 the
  2 50 following:
  3  1    "Sec. ___.  Section 99F.4A, subsection 2, Code
  3  2 l997, is amended to read as follows:
  3  3    2.  A license to operate gambling games shall be
  3  4 issued only to a licensee holding a valid license to
  3  5 conduct pari-mutuel dog or horse racing pursuant to
  3  6 chapter 99D on January 1, 1994.  However, a license to
  3  7 operate gambling games issued pursuant to this
  3  8 subsection may be transferred to another person after
  3  9 a majority of the voters of the county in which the
  3 10 racetrack enclosure is located, voting on the transfer
  3 11 proposal, approves it.  The transfer proposal shall be
  3 12 submitted by the board of supervisors at a general
  3 13 election or a special election called for that
  3 14 purpose.  If the proposal is approved, the issuance of
  3 15 a new license is subject to application to, and
  3 16 approval by, the commission.
  3 17    Sec. ___.  Section 99F.4A, Code 1997, is amended by
  3 18 adding the following new subsection:
  3 19    NEW SUBSECTION.  8.  A civil penalty imposed by the
  3 20 commission on a licensee relating to a violation of
  3 21 legal age for gambling or pari-mutuel wagering shall
  3 22 not exceed one thousand dollars per incident if the
  3 23 violator is removed by the licensee.
  3 24    Sec. ___.  Section 99F.4A, Code 1997, is amended by
  3 25 adding the following new subsection:
  3 26    NEW SUBSECTION.  9.  If a license issued pursuant
  3 27 to this chapter or chapter 99D is transferred, an
  3 28 existing collective bargaining agreement or the impact
  3 29 of an employee representation election shall transfer
  3 30 to the new licensee.
  3 31    Sec. ___.  NEW SECTION.  99F.5A  MORATORIUM FOR
  3 32 ISSUANCE OF LICENSES FOR EXCURSION GAMBLING BOATS AND
  3 33 ON THE NUMBER AND TYPE OF GAMBLING GAMES.
  3 34    1.  The total number of licenses issued to conduct
  3 35 gambling games on excursion gambling boats pursuant to
  3 36 this chapter shall not exceed ten until July 1, 2003.
  3 37    2.  Notwithstanding subsection 1, the following
  3 38 actions may be taken during the moratorium from July
  3 39 1, 1998, until July 1, 2003, with the approval of the
  3 40 commission:
  3 41    a.  A licensed excursion gambling boat may move to
  3 42 a new location within the same county.
  3 43    b.  A licensed excursion gambling boat or a pari-
  3 44 mutuel racetrack and its facilities may be sold and a
  3 45 new license may be issued for operation in the same
  3 46 county.
  3 47    c.  If a license to conduct gambling games on an
  3 48 excursion gambling boat is surrendered, not renewed,
  3 49 or revoked, a new license may be issued for operation
  3 50 in the same county.
  4  1    3.  During the moratorium from July 1, 1999, until
  4  2 July 1, 2003, the commission shall not authorize any
  4  3 of the following:
  4  4    a.  An increase in the number of gambling games or
  4  5 the number of slot machines on an excursion gambling
  4  6 boat.
  4  7    b.  A number of slot machines at a pari-mutuel
  4  8 racetrack which is greater than the number authorized
  4  9 on or before July 1, 1999.
  4 10    4.  The commission shall not authorize a licensee
  4 11 to conduct pari-mutuel wagering at a licensed premises
  4 12 in more than one county.
  4 13    Sec. ___.  Section 99F.7, subsection 1, Code 1997,
  4 14 is amended to read as follows:
  4 15    1.  If the commission is satisfied that this
  4 16 chapter and its rules adopted under this chapter
  4 17 applicable to licensees have been or will be complied
  4 18 with, the commission shall issue a license for a
  4 19 period of not more than three years to an applicant to
  4 20 own a gambling game operation and to an applicant to
  4 21 operate an excursion gambling boat.  The commission
  4 22 shall decide which of the gambling games authorized
  4 23 under this chapter it will permit.  The commission
  4 24 shall decide the number, location, and type of
  4 25 excursion gambling boats licensed under this chapter
  4 26 for operation on the rivers, lakes, and reservoirs of
  4 27 this state.  However, after July 1, 2003, the
  4 28 commission shall issue a new license for an excursion
  4 29 gambling boat operation only if the excursion gambling
  4 30 boat operates on the Mississippi or Missouri river.
  4 31 The license shall set forth the name of the licensee,
  4 32 the type of license granted, the place where the
  4 33 excursion gambling boats will operate and dock, and
  4 34 the time and number of days during the excursion
  4 35 season and the off season when gambling may be
  4 36 conducted by the licensee.  The commission shall not
  4 37 allow a licensee to conduct gambling games on an
  4 38 excursion gambling boat while docked during the off
  4 39 season if the licensee does not operate gambling
  4 40 excursions for a minimum number of days during the
  4 41 excursion season.  The commission may delay the
  4 42 commencement of the excursion season at the request of
  4 43 a licensee.
  4 44    Sec. ___.  Section 805.8, Code Supplement 1997, is
  4 45 amended by adding the following new subsection:
  4 46    NEW SUBSECTION.  13.  GAMBLING VIOLATIONS.  For
  4 47 violations of legal age for gambling or pari-mutuel
  4 48 wagering under section 99D.11, subsection 7, section
  4 49 99E.18, subsection 5, or section 99F.9, subsection 5,
  4 50 the scheduled fine is one hundred dollars.  Failure to
  5  1 pay the fine by a person under the age of eighteen
  5  2 shall not result in the person being detained in a
  5  3 secure facility.""
